What is a goal of the Stabilization Level of the OPT Model?

Enhance joint stability

What focuses on increasing muscle size?

Hypertrophy training

Which term refers to the ability of muscles to exert maximal power in a minimal amount of time?

Rate of force production

The rate of force production relates to the ability of muscles to do what?

Exert maximal force output in a minimal amount of time

What is a primary focus of exercising in the Stabilization level of training?

Muscular endurance

What is the primary cause of musculoskeletal degeneration in the adult population?

Low-back pain

What is neuromuscular efficiency?

Ability of neuromuscular system to enable all muscles to efficiently work together in all planes of motion.

Which term refers to the cumulative sensory input to the central nervous system from all mechanoreceptors that sense position and limb movements?

Proprioception

What best defines muscle imbalance?

Alteration of muscle length surrounding a joint.

According to the Optimum Performance Training (OPT) model, what is a goal of the Maximal Strength Phase of training?

Increase peak force production.

What involves performing exercises in a superset sequence?

Strength endurance training

What is muscle that acts as the initial and main source of motive power?

Prime mover

According to the Optimum Performance Training (OPT) model, what corresponds to the first phase of training?

Stabilization endurance training

For which populations would hypertrophy training be most beneficial?

Body builders

The first exercise during Strength Endurance training involves a traditional strength exercise, such as a bench press, that is performed in a stable environment in order to elicit what?

Prime mover strength

What is the best example of performing an exercise in a proprioceptively enriched environment?

Dumbbell chest press on stability ball

What is an example that exhibits the conditions for being classified as obese?

An individual with a body mass index equal to or higher than 30.
